Freeman, per a source in Cincinnati with direct knowledge, had told his Bearcats’ linebackers Friday afternoon that he was departing and had chosen to accept LSU’s offer. Notre Dame sources had told FootballScoop earlier on Friday that the Irish appeared out of the mix to land Freeman, the Broyles Award semifinalist in 2020 after a third-straight season of stellar work atop the Bearcats’ defensive unit.

But Friday afternoon, Notre Dame leaders huddled and made another effort with Freeman, included an improved salary offer over the term of the deal, per sources with knowledge of the developments.
